Activity Description

Arachnoiditis is a persistent inflammation of the arachnoid mater and subarachnoid space due to mechanical, chemical, or infectious causes. It is a rare but serious condition not well understood by some medical personnel. In its most severe form, adhesive arachnoiditis can be a very painful and debilitating condition. It is, therefore, important for practitioners to have an understanding of this condition to help identify, treat, and hopefully avoid this condition. This activity reviews the causes as well as the evaluation and management of arachnoiditis, highlighting the role of the inter-professional team in improving care for patients suffering from this condition.
